In Cranford, it is the women, not the men, who make the rules: if you want to know anything, you only need to ask one of the Cranford ladies. Cranford is a small town where the most important things are kindness and friendliness between neighbours. This is story of life there in the changing world of England in the 1840s. This award-winning collection of adapted classic literature and original stories develops reading skills for low-beginning through advanced students. Accessible language and carefully controlled vocabulary build students' reading confidence. Introductions at the beginning of each story, illustrations throughout, and glossaries help build comprehension. Before, during, and after reading activities included in the back of each book strengthen student comprehension.
